Output f04cbf85dcd0e54df42a85834b0be2ff3bc5c2a863f17e830e44cc5a1d82da45:0

value
26028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80b256d5253e428210399426b49740f91a193304 OP_EQUAL
address
3DRW4Ke6tWYfVDh3xAbCrAn3KDE5Av9N2W
transaction
f04cbf85dcd0e54df42a85834b0be2ff3bc5c2a863f17e830e44cc5a1d82da45
confirmations
155030
spent
true